pythonsplit多个
‘壹’ python split
楼主你好!
python中的split()不带任何参数是个很好用的特性:忽略具体的空格数来分割字符串。
请看一下代码:
handle_string='HelloWhatYourName'
printhandle_string.split()
运行结果:
['Hello', 'What', 'Your', 'Name']
不难发现这样调用的结果是不会考虑字符串中字母间空格的具体数量的,假如按一下代码:
handle_string='HelloWhatYourName'
printhandle_string.split('')
则运行结果(即按单个空格来分割):
['Hello', 'What', '', 'Your', '', '', 'Name']
在Linux系统下,当你抓取一下工具显示的据数据时,往往这些工具为了美观,会用空格符来进行排版。此时要读取数据,用split()就会显得特别方便。
望采纳,谢谢!
‘贰’ python中split的用法.
字符串的split函数默认分隔符是空格 ' '
如果没有分隔符,就把整个字符串作为列表的一个元素
‘叁’ python中split怎么使用
一、描述
split() 通过指定分隔符对字符串进行切片,如果第二个参数 num 有指定值,则分割为 num+1 个子字符串。
二、语法
split() 方法语法:
str.split(str="", num=string.count(str))
三、参数
str -- 分隔符,默认为所有的空字符,包括空格、换行( )、制表符( )等。
num -- 分割次数。默认为 -1, 即分隔所有。
四、返回值
返回分割后的字符串行表。
五、示例
split()函数示例
‘肆’ python中split的具体用法
字符串的split函数默认分隔符是空格
'
'
如果没有分隔符,就把整个字符串作为列表的一个元素
‘伍’ python 中split的用法,如何分解多字符串的数据
split('|')
‘陆’ Python中同时用多个分隔符分割字符串的问题
这种情况一般用正则表达式分割
importre
s='Hello!This?Is!What?I!Want'
ss=re.split('[!?]',s)
#ss=['Hello','This','Is','What','I','Want']
‘柒’ python splte如何分隔有多个相同符号的str
str="你的string内容"
str_split=str.split('相同的符号')
执行完了以后再在相同符号的地方就分割开,变成一个字符串的数组。
‘捌’ python中split的具体用法
words = line.split(" ")
读入一行字符Line 以空格“ ”分隔词 返回一堆单词列表list
‘玖’ python 多个分隔符 如何splict
直接用string里的split似乎也能做到,没有试过。不过通常我们是用re里的split
比如这样子
s=open(strFilename).read()
importre
results=re.split("(?isu)[,.]+",s)
可以套用。
‘拾’ Python 2 里面怎么根据多个分隔符分裂字符串
使用re.split(regex, str)
比如根据!或者:分割,a!b:c!d,那么
re.split('!|:','a!b:c!d')